Death on the Nile: Review

Death on the Nile is another fun whodunit movie!

The story line was a lot more emotional then I was expecting. You really cared of these characters, and by the end of the movie, you really felt emotional for what some of them would have to live with, and what they experienced.

The acting was outstanding, contrary to what the critics said. Kenneth Branagh once again did a fabulous job as Detective Hercule Poirot. Gal Gadot did an excellent job as well and it was sad that she was the one who got killed. Letitia Wright's performance was very emotional, and I felt bad for her in so many ways. For me personally, Russell Brand was the most surprisingly good performance in this. I just really liked him the most for some reason.

The twist was one I had actually called, but I later didn't think I was right cause it was way too predictable, good job as misdirection by director Kenneth Branagh. 

The only minor flaw I had with this film, was that it started out really slow. But when it got going, holy moly!

In terms of a sequel, there are so many directions they can take this franchise. I am really looking forward to the 3rd one.

Out of 4 stars I would give it...

3.5 out of 4
